Hagia Sophia / upper gallery

Architects: Isidore of Miletus and Anthemius of Tralles, AD537. Showing the south upper gallery which, according to experts, was once the domain of the Empress and the other women of the court. This image also records many of the Islamic additions to the interior including the large discs of calligraphy, chandeliers and aniconic mosaics. Istanbul, Turkey.
